Re: Alder Flats?

Use google or mapquest to figure out your best route to Alder flats. Head strait thru town and keep heading west. After about 6 or 7 km you will see the Rose Creek day use site, there is a big parking lot there and there is usually lots of units that parked around there. You can quad out from there; my experience is that I usually go south west from there. If you want to go another 6 or 7 km the main road takes a sharp left turn to the south (there is a radio tower there too) and I have parked there a number of times. I was there 2 weekends ago and had a blast, tons of mud, tons of trails - one of my favorite places to go, I hope to go again before the snow sets in.
